Working on the back straight.

Hills are foam and plaster soaked chux clothes, plus some fly screen and newspaper coated in plaster clothes. Rocks are from rubber moulds. I have been busy processing some foam to cover the hills - will use a mix of static grass, ground foam and some small trees I have from my model railroad days.

Having fun - figure once I get this mostly finished I can paint and tape as most of the other scenery I can reach from the front.

Rocks aren't finished I am working on getting the shading right...
